## Runbook: Account Recovery — Slimline Build Service

If the service account for the Slimline image-slimming pipeline is locked, do this:

1. Confirm lockout in the Ferrowatch audit log.
2. File an incident, severity 3.
3. Request unlock from the duty admin.
4. Re-run the base-image trim job to verify access.

The duty admin will challenge you for the recovery passphrase, which follows.

unlock words, hahip-baduf: holwyn-istath-julvan

Action item: The Relayn deploy-status bot silently dropped updates when the pipeline API paginated results, so responders believed a rollback had completed when it had not. We will add pagination handling, a staleness banner, and an integration test. Until merged, verify deploy state directly in the pipeline console, documented at the page below.

runbook for kahop-kajop: https://rundeck.ordinio.test/display/secrets/pipeline/issue/pages/repo/browse/e5732776e07d1285107e5aeb

Spare hardware — keyboards, monitors, docking stations, and loan laptops — is kept in Storage Room G12 on the ground floor of the Kettlewick building, next to the print hub. New starters may take one of each standard item during their first week; anything beyond that needs a ticket to the tech desk. Please log whatever you take on the clipboard inside the door. The keypad code for G12 is below.

turnstile pass: bdg-FYC-7